Transaction 77fe24d6ef85c261333d530fa35f5b419fcc37c58d0c6d5b3641a774beef2a32
1 Input
1 Output
-
77fe24d6ef85c261333d530fa35f5b419fcc37c58d0c6d5b3641a774beef2a32:0
- value
- 498429
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a885280a4e6f68c211a3a821bea2697a1b75659
- address
- bc1qd2y99q9yummgcgg682pph63xj7smw4je52l2n4